Dusan Vlahovic transfer news

Dusan Vlahovic has been a major name during the last few transfer windows.

While it was Juventus who beat Arsenal to his signing in Janaury 2022, the Serbian international is expected to leave the Turin giants.

According to Fabrizio Romano, PSG, Chelsea and Bayern Munich are all interested.

David Datro Fofana close to leaving Chelsea

The outgoings at Chelsea continue.

According to Fabrizio Romano, striker David Datro Fofana is close to leaving the Blues on loan.

German side Union Berlin are reportedly closing in a move, though there is not though to be the option of a permanent deal.

Liverpool prepared to pay Khephren Thuram’s asking price

Despite signing two midfielders already, Liverpool are on the lookout for more players in that area.

Indeed, Khephren Thuram is constantly linked with a move to the club this summer and is expected to leave Nice.

Now, according to Spanish source Nacional, the Frenchman could soon join.

They claim the Reds are willing to pay his £25.6m asking price.

Federico Valverde: Liverpool told they already have better options

Liverpool have been strongly linked with a move for Real Madrid star Federico Valverde all summer.

Still, Jurgen Klopp has since been told he already has TWO better options in the middle of the park.

Speaking to ESPN, former Anfield hero Steve Nicol said: “Listen, Valverde’s not getting let go from Real Madrid because he’s that great. If Real Madrid are prepared to let him go, it tells you that they don’t think he’s the future.

“Liverpool have just signed Mac Allister, Szoboszlai, they already have Fabinho, Henderson’s still around for another year.

“Curtis Jones, Harvey Elliott, two young guys, particularly Elliott, who will play. Does he start before Szoboszlai? No. Does he start before Mac Allister? No.

“So, if you’re Valverde, you’re going to be thinking about that as well. Thiago’s still there. So if I’m Valverde, I’m thinking, number one, they’re [Real Madrid] prepared to let me go. Two, do I start [at Liverpool]?”

Man United battle Newcastle for Disasi deal

Manchester United are reportedly going head to head with Newcastle for the signing of Axel Disasi in this window.

The French defender has long been on United’s transfer radar and was thought to be closing in on a move to Old Trafford earlier this summer.

However, the deal never transpired and Fabrizio Romano now reports that both United and Newcastle want to sign Disasi.

Both sides have been in talks with the player’s camp, but have yet to submit official bids to Monaco. One to watch this week!
